In 2000 there were 61 single family homes (or 57.5% of the total) out of a total of 106 inhabited buildings. There were 13 multi-family buildings (12.3%), along with 27 multi-purpose buildings that were mostly used for housing (25.5%) and 5 other use buildings (commercial or industrial) that also

As of 2000, there were 133 private households in the municipality, and an average of 2.7 persons per household. There were 24 households that consist of only one person and 15 households with five or more people. Out of a total of 135 households that answered this question, 17.8% were households

Combremont-le-Petit has an area, as of 2009, of 5.73 square kilometers (2.21 sq mi). Of this area, 4.15 km (1.60 sq mi) or 72.4% is used for agricultural purposes, while 1.31 km (0.51 sq mi) or 22.9% is forested. Of the rest of the land, 0.28 km

Of the population in the municipality 137 or about 37.2% were born in
Combremont-le-Petit and lived there in 2000. There were 125 or 34.0% who were born in the same canton, while 76 or 20.7% were born somewhere else in Switzerland, and 25 or 6.8% were born outside of Switzerland.

As of 2000, there were 158 people who were single and never married in the municipality. There were 188 married individuals, 12 widows or widowers and 10 individuals who are divorced.
